The Gyrlz was an R&B girl group consisting of members Monica Bryce, Terri Robinson, and Tara Geter. The girls were backup singers for a couple of acts during the late 80's and their demo tape was produced by Teddy Riley and Kyle West. They met Andre Harrell and started work on their album. Their debut and only album, "Love Me Or Leave Me" was released in 1988. They released two singles "Jam Jam (If You Can)" and "If It's Games You're Playing." Another single, "Wishing You Were Here" was a moderate success. The group sang backup with singer Al B. Sure on his "Heartbreak" tour and became the opening act for New Edition and Bobby Brown. By the end of Al B. Sure's tour, the girls split up. After the breakup, Terri went to New York, singing for another group called Key West, but the group never released an album. After that, Terri reunited with former member Monica and became a duo.
